As new input may arrive at any time, it is possible to miss the "RX FIFO empty" condition, forcing the loop to wait until it times out. Nothing in the i202 Advisory states that such a wait is even necessary; other FIFO clear functions like serial8250_clear_fifos() do not wait either. For this reason, it seems safe to remove the wait, fixing the mentioned issue.
